How to Master Stunt Courses

Managing Ramp Approach Speed

Every ramp in this group cares about the seconds before takeoff. Too little speed and a launch stalls short; too much, and you overshoot the landing zone entirely. On tighter layouts like Turbo Cars: Pipe Stunts, easing off before a curve matters as much as flooring it into a straight run.

Correcting Angle and Landing Impact

In the air, small corrections beat big ones. Nose-heavy landings punish flips in Stunt Paradise, while Sky Riders' floating platforms leave little margin for a crooked touchdown. Games built around destruction, like Hyper Cars Ramp Crash, are more forgiving of a rough landing, but even there, a level approach keeps you moving toward the next ramp instead of stopping to recover.
